Projected change in dependency ratio depending on labor force participation
– Age dependency is the ratio between people defined as dependents (under-15s and over-65s) and working-age people.– Labor force dependency does not take into account age brackets but instead uses the ratio between those not participating in the workforce to those that are.– High labor force participation assumes a higher share of people participating in the workforce (e.g. beyond the age of 65).
